Chapter 4: UEFI BIOS
121
Wake On LAN
Set this feature to support system wake-up via the selected LAN device. If this feature is
set to Enabled, the LAN port selected will be enabled when the system is powered on. The
options are Disabled and Enabled.
Legacy Virtual LAN ID
Species the VLAN ID used for PXE VLAN mode. The valid VLAN ID range is from 0
to 4049. PXE VLAN is disabled if the VLAN ID is set to 0. Note that this settings is only
applicable when the system ROM boots in Legacy BIOS mode.
PCI Virtual Functions Advertised
This feature displays the base PCI virtual functions advertised.
ISCSI Conguration
iSCSI General Parameters
TCP/IP Parameters via DHCP
Use this feature to acquire TCP/IP conguration from DHCP. Options are Disabled and
Enabled.
iSCSI Parameters via DHCP (Available when "TCP/IP Parameters via DHCP" is
set to Enabled)
Use this feature to acquire iSCSI conguration from DHCP. Options are Disabled and
Enabled.
CHAP Authentication
Use this feature to enable or disable CHAP authentication. Options are Disabled and
Enabled.
CHAP Mutual Authentication (Available when "CHAP Authentication" is set to
Enabled)
Use this feature to enable or disable mutual CHAP authentication. Options are Disabled
and Enabled. If enabled, enter the CHAP ID and password in the iSCSI Initiator Param-
eters page.
IP Version
This feature controls whether IPv4 or IPv6 network address will be used for iSCSI initiator
and targets. Currently only IPv4 is supported.
